L1012. A rear three-quarter view of Hawthorn Black 0-4-0 saddletank, MAY, owned by Mackay & Davies (Contractors) of Cardiff. The locomotive is seen when working on the construction of the Great Western & Great Central Joint Railway section between High Wycombe and Princes Risborough, sometime around 1903. The picture shows MAY hauling two tipping wagons containing a gang of seven navvies. The locomotive's crew stand on their steed, the drive in the cab. | |
